中文摘要microcystin-lr (mc-lr) is one of the hepatotoxins produced by cyanobacteria in the eutrophicated fresh water. in this work, the minor groove binding mode of mc-lr to plasmid dna was explored by using uv and fluorescence spectra, and the binding characteristics of mc-lr for plasmid dna were calculated via the fluorescence quenching of ethidium bromide (eb) and mole ratio method. furthermore, atomic force microscopy (afm) was used to observe dna morphology change in the presence of mc-lr. with the increasing concentration of, mc-lr, circle dna strands twined gradually to rod condensates. the possible reason for the condensation might be the masking of the electrostatic repulsion between dna double strands by mc-lr the present study might provide useful information for the pathopoiesis mechanism of mc-lr. more, because the condensation of dna could affect the progresses of gene expression and protein transcription, it may implicate another trend to explore the nosogenesis of mc-lr.
